Hi, On Fri, Aug 05, 2016 at 09:32:35AM +0200, Steffan Karger wrote: > MSVC 2015 claims to support C99 now (took them 16 years!), and it > should at least support %zu (which is part of C99). Shouldn't we just > move (at least the master branch) to C99? Or are there good reasons > to keep punishing ourselves with having to support C89?
Well, I'd assume that %zu is more a libc thing (as printf() format parsing
happens at runtime) than what the C compiler understands - and if, say,
Win7 libc.dll (or however it's called) doesn't grok %zu, we can't use
it...
This is why I was asking what breaks exactly :-)
